Get to know Family Physician Dr. Jose N. Prieto, who serves patients in Downey, California.
Dr. Prieto is an experienced family physician who specializes in caring for people of all ages, at all stages of life. He is affiliated with PIH Health Downey Hospital.
PIH Health Downey Hospital is a non-profit community-based hospital located in Downey, California. The hospital operates a family medicine residency program for newly graduated osteopathic physicians. “Our mission is to provide high-quality healthcare, without discrimination, and contribute to the health and well-being of our communities in an ethical, safe, and fiscally prudent manner, in recognition of our charitable purpose” as stated on their website.
A 1960 graduate of the Higher Institute of Medical Sciences of Havana, Dr. Prieto relocated to the United States to further his training. Once there, he served his residency in family medicine at the West Los Angeles Veterans Affairs Medical Center.
With an unwavering commitment to his speciality, the doctor is board-certified in family medicine by the American Board of Family Medicine (ABFM). The ABFM is a non-profit, independent medical association of American physicians who practice in family medicine and its sub-specialties.
Family medicine is a medical specialty devoted to comprehensive health care for people of all ages. The specialist is called a family physician or family doctor. A family physician is often the first person a patient sees when seeking healthcare services. They examine and treat patients with a wide range of conditions and refer those with serious ailments to a specialist or appropriate facility.
On a more personal note, Dr. Prieto speaks both English and Spanish.
